Dhanaraj M wrote:


I had a quick look:

> ***************
> *** 209,215 ****
>   
>   	/* Return command status if wanted */
>   	if (completionTag)
> ! 		snprintf(completionTag, COMPLETION_TAG_BUFSIZE, "%s %ld",
>   				 stmt->ismove ? "MOVE" : "FETCH",
>   				 nprocessed);
>   }
> --- 209,215 ----
>   
>   	/* Return command status if wanted */
>   	if (completionTag)
> ! 		snprintf(completionTag, COMPLETION_TAG_BUFSIZE, "%s %lld",
>   				 stmt->ismove ? "MOVE" : "FETCH",
>   				 nprocessed);
>   }

You shouldn't be using %lld as it breaks on some platforms.
Use INT64_FORMAT instead.

> --- ./src/backend/parser/gram.y	Sun Aug 13 00:06:28 2006
> ***************
> *** 116,122 ****
>   
>   %union
>   {
> ! 	int					ival;
>   	char				chr;
>   	char				*str;
>   	const char			*keyword;
> --- 116,122 ----
>   
>   %union
>   {
> ! 	int64				ival;
>   	char				chr;
>   	char				*str;
>   	const char			*keyword;

I don't think this is the right approach.  Maybe it would be reasonable
to add another arm to the %union instead, not sure.  The problem is the
amount of ugly casts you have to use below.  The scanner code seems to
think that a constant larger than the biggest int4 should be treated as
float, so I'm not sure why this would work anyway.
